Mickle Pickle Espresso is a funky foodie’s cafe run by an ex-Masterchef candidate*, found in an unlikely location on Tingalpa’s busy Wynnum Rd.

And whether a local or traveller en route to Wynnum or Manly, it makes a worthy stop for a delicious all day breakfast and an excellent cup of coffee - look out for the Vespa which stands sentry out front on the astro-turfed terrace.

Drop by for something as simple as toast with spreads, fruit toast, Bircher Muesli, Smashed Avo on rye from nearby Uncle Bob’s Bakery or Poached/fried/scrambled eggs with sourdough and relish, all for under $10.

On the heartier side there’s Eggs Benny with sourdough, served with spinach and Hollandaise sauce and a choice of ham/bacon or smoked salmon, a Paleo Brekky incorporating the works – bacon, eggs, mushroom, tomato, spinach, avo and Paleo sourdough.

Otherwise try one of chef Michael’s signature dishes like the highly recommended Roasted Field Mushrooms, spinach, feta, balsamic and house made pesto or Smoked Ham Hock House beans, topped with fried egg, on soy and linseed sourdough.

Coffee at Mickle Pickle is well-brewed Genovese and other drinks include iced coffee or chocolate , pomegranate or mango frappes, all manner of shakes, banana or mango smoothies, Grubb Bros cold brew, coconut water and Soho organic soft drinks.

Need to know – Mickle Pickle is child-friendly, with a kids table with cute toadstool seats and a basket of toys and books outside on the astroturf; it is also dog-friendly, with a water bowl provided and spot to secure pooch at the bicycle racks.

Nice to know – There is free off-street parking adjacent to Mickle Pickle. Those in a hurry can text ahead for coffee.

*Michael the owner was one of the Top 50 Masterchef contenders from Series 3.
